We believe it is important to help correct the gender imbalance in tech. Announcing the second ‘Next 100 Women In Tech’ free networking event to be held 12th October 2017.
It's an important day where we focus on encouraging more women to pursue a career in the ICT sector. We do this by facilitating opportunities for you to network, share experiences and discuss strategic solutions to some of your specific challenges.
With only 14% of executive roles currently led by women, there is a lot of work to do to attain gender balance across the Australian tech sector. The Next 100 Women in Tech event in October will feature some of Australia’s most inspiring leaders in the sector, and will help develop pathways for women in ICT.
Taking place at Engineers Australia, Level 31, 600 Bourke St, Melbourne, the event will bring women together to examine how we can overcome the gender barriers holding women back from their true potential, and provide a forum for tech job seekers and employers to network and talk about job opportunities.
